Rhodium-catalyzed hydrosilylation of internal alkynes with silane reagents bearing heteroatom substituents. Studies on the regio-/stereochemistry and transformation of the produced alkenylsilanes by rhodium-catalyzed conjugate addition

Rhodium-catalyzed hydrosilylation of internal alkynes furnished (E)-1,2-disubstituted alkenylsilanes. The obtained alkenylsilane was subjected to reaction with alpha,beta-unsaturated carbonyl compounds in the presence of a rhodium catalyst to undergo conjugate addition. One-pot hydrosilylation-conjugate addition with a rhodium catalyst was also performed.
